To determine which statement is not true about refraction, we need to examine each statement individually:

A. "Refraction occurs when light's velocity changes."
This statement is true. Refraction is the bending of light as it passes from one medium to another, and this bending is caused by the change in the velocity of light.

B. "The angle between the refracted ray and the normal is called the angle of refraction."
This statement is also true. The angle of refraction is the angle between the refracted ray and the normal, which is an imaginary line perpendicular to the surface of the boundary between the two media.

C. "When light moves from a rarer to a denser medium, it bends toward the normal."
This statement is true. When light passes from a medium with a lower refractive index (rarer medium) to a medium with a higher refractive index (denser medium), it bends towards the normal, which is the line perpendicular to the boundary surface.

D. "The path of a light ray that crosses the boundary between two different media is irreversible."
This statement is not true. The path of a light ray that crosses the boundary between two media is reversible, meaning that if the light ray passes from the second medium back to the first medium, it will follow the same path but in the opposite direction.

Therefore, statement D is the incorrect statement about refraction.
